Both "Mrs. and Dr." and "Dr. and Mrs." can be correct, depending on the context. Typically, "Dr. and Mrs." is used when referring to a couple where one is a doctor, while "Mrs. and Dr." might be used in specific situations where the emphasis is on the title of the wife first. Generally, it's more common to list titles in order of rank or importance, which often leads to "Dr. and Mrs." being the preferred format.

Yes, Bernice King is alive. She is the youngest daughter of civil rights leader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. and Coretta Scott King. Bernice King is an attorney, author, and the CEO of The King Center in Atlanta, Georgia, where she continues her family's legacy of advocating for social justice and equality.
